首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ql导出数据库表表格

MySQL导出数据库表格是指将MySQL数据库中的表格数据以某种格式进行导出的操作。这个过程可以通过使用MySQL的命令行工具、图形化工具或编程语言等方式来完成。

MySQL提供了多种导出数据的方式,包括CSV、SQL、Excel、XML、JSON等格式。下面将介绍其中几种常用的导出方式:

  1. 导出为CSV格式: CSV(Comma Separated Values)是一种常用的逗号分隔的文本文件格式,易于读取和处理。可以通过以下步骤导出MySQL表格为CSV格式:
    • 使用命令行工具,执行以下命令:
    • 使用命令行工具,执行以下命令:
    • 这将把表格数据导出到指定的CSV文件中。
    • 使用图形化工具,如Navicat、MySQL Workbench等,选择需要导出的表格,右键点击选择"导出",选择CSV格式并指定导出路径即可。
  • 导出为SQL格式: SQL格式可以保存表格的结构和数据,并且可以用于数据库的备份和恢复。可以通过以下步骤导出MySQL表格为SQL格式:
    • 使用命令行工具,执行以下命令:
    • 使用命令行工具,执行以下命令:
    • 这将把表格结构和数据导出到指定的SQL文件中。
    • 使用图形化工具,如Navicat、MySQL Workbench等,选择需要导出的表格,右键点击选择"导出",选择SQL格式并指定导出路径即可。
  • 导出为Excel格式: Excel格式是一种电子表格格式,广泛应用于数据分析和报告中。可以通过以下步骤导出MySQL表格为Excel格式:
    • 使用图形化工具,如Navicat、MySQL Workbench等,选择需要导出的表格,右键点击选择"导出",选择Excel格式并指定导出路径即可。

以上是常见的几种导出MySQL数据库表格的方式,具体选择哪种方式取决于个人需求和实际情况。作为一个专家和开发工程师,你可以根据不同的场景和要求灵活选择合适的导出方式。

腾讯云提供了云数据库 TencentDB for MySQL,它是一种高可用、可扩展、安全可靠的云数据库服务,可用于存储和管理MySQL数据库。你可以通过腾讯云控制台或API等方式进行操作和管理,具体产品介绍和详细信息请参考腾讯云官网文档:https://cloud.tencent.com/document/product/236/30941

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 程序员常用mysql命令

    授权指定IP连接: grant all on *.* to root@'127.0.0.1' identified by 'root110'; 其中root为访问数据库的用户名,而root110为用户的密码。 导入带中文的SQL: mysql -uroot -proot110 table < table.sql -f --default-character-set=utf8 要注意加上-f --default-character-set=utf8 导出数据库表: mysqldump -uroot -p db_name > db.sql(root为访问数据库的用户名,-p表示需要输入密码,db_name为需要导出的数据库名,db.sql为存储导出结果的文件) 如果只想导出指定的表,则可在db_name后留一空格后跟上表名即可。 导入数据文件(字段间以一个空格分隔,文件d.txt要放到目标数据库的数据目录下,如:/usr/local/mysql/data/test): load data INFILE 'd.txt' INTO TABLE x FIELDS TERMINATED BY ' '; 增加普通索引(x为表名,idx_c为索引名,f_field1为字段名): ALTER  TABLE  `x`  ADD  INDEX idx_c (`f_field1` );

    05

    程序员不常用Linux命令集

    1) 关闭指定网卡,如关闭网卡eth0 ifconfig eth0 down 也可以使用ifdown,通常ifdown是一个指向ifup的软链接,而ifup为一个脚本文件。 2) 命令自启动,如希望机器重启时自动关闭网卡eth0 这个只需要在文件/etc/rc.d/rc.local中添加一行“ifconfig eth0 down”即可。 3) 进入MySQL终端界面示例: mysql -h127.0.01 -P3306 -uroot -p'password' database 127.0.0.1为DB的IP地址,3306为DB的服务端口号,root为访问它的用户名,password为访问它的密码,databse为需要访问的数据库 参数database是可选的,建议password使用单引号括起来,以避免shell对它进行转义处理,比如如果密码中包含感叹号字符"!",使用双引号时需要使用斜杠“\”转义。 如果不想进入MySQL界面,只需要在上述基础上再带上参数“-e'SQL'”,如: mysql -h127.0.01 -P3306 -uroot -p'password' test -e'show tables' 4) MySQL授权指定IP连接: grant all on *.* to root@'127.0.0.1' identified by 'root110'; 其中root为访问数据库的用户名,而root110为用户的密码。 5) MySQL导入带中文的SQL: mysql -uroot -proot110 table < table.sql -f --default-character-set=utf8 要注意加上-f --default-character-set=utf8 6) MySQL导出数据库表: mysqldump -uroot -p db_name > db.sql(root为访问数据库的用户名,-p表示需要输入密码,db_name为需要导出的数据库名,db.sql为存储导出结果的文件) 如果只想导出指定的表,则可在db_name后留一空格后跟上表名即可。 7) 重启Linux服务,如重启cron: service cron restart 将上面的restart改成stop为停止,改成start为启动。 8) 网络访问策略: 禁止指定网段访问(24对应的掩码为255.255.255.0): iptables -I INPUT -s 10.6.208.0/24 -j DROP iptables -I INPUT -s 10.6.223.0/24 -j DROP iptables -I INPUT -s 10.6.224.0/24 -j DROP 为保证上述操作在机器重启后仍然有效,执行以下操作: iptables-save > /etc/sysconfig/iptables 这样IP地址:10.6.208.101、10.6.223.31和10.6.224.219等就不能访问目标机器了。 9) 日期操作 # date +%s 1479791653 # date --date='@1479791653' Tue Nov 22 13:14:13 CST 2016 10) 查找进程工作目录命令: pwdx 如: pwdx `pidof test`

    02
    领券